body {
margin: 0px;
padding: 0px;
font-family: "Trebuchet MS", Verdana, "Lucida Grande", Tahoma, Helvetica, Sans-Serif;
font-size: 12px;
background-color: #00257E;
}
img {
border: 0;
}
a {
}
p {
margin: 0;
padding: 0;
}
#conteneur {
background-color: #fff;
width: 900px;
margin: auto;
}
/* TinyMCE specific rules */
body.mceContentBody {
background-image: none;
background-color: #fff;
}
#header {
background-image: url(images/bg-header.jpg);
height: 225px;
}
#gauche {
margin: 0;
padding:0;
float: left;
background-image: url(images/bg-gauche.jpg);
width: 309px;
height: 452px;
}
/************* POUR FIXER UNE HAUTEUR MINIMUM **********************/
#contenu {
width: 570px;
height: 420px;
padding: 20px 10px 20px 10px;
float: left;
}
html>body #contenu {
height: auto;
min-height: 420px;
}
/************* FIN FIXER UNE HAUTEUR MINIMUM **********************/
#footer0 {
letter-spacing: 1px;
background-color: #E7F0FC;
text-align: center;
font-size: 10px;
padding: 10px; 
clear: both;
color: #00257E;
}
#footer {
letter-spacing: 1px;
text-align: center;
font-size: 10px;
padding: 10px; 
background-color: #00257E;
}
#footer a {
color: #4D67A5;
}
#footer a:hover {
color: #99A8CB;
}
a {
text-decoration: none;
}
a:hover {
text-decoration: underline;
}
h1 {
font-size: 24px;
border-bottom: 1px solid;
color: #886e1f;
}
h2 {
font-size: 18px;
border-bottom: 1px solid;
text-align: center;
font-variant: small-caps;
color: #886E1F;
}
h3 {
color: #7F92BE;
font-size: 14px;
border-bottom: 1px solid #7F92BE;
padding-bottom: 5px;;
}
h4 {
font-size: 14px;
color: #00257E;
}
p {
color: #00257E;
}
/**********************************************************************
                               MENU
**********************************************************************/
#menu {
}
.menu1 span, .menu2 span, .menu3 span, .menu4 span, .menu5 span, .menu6 span {
display: none;
}
.menu1 , .menu2, .menu3, .menu4, .menu5, .menu6 {
height: 28px;
display: block;
float: left;
}
.menu1 {
width: 77px;
}
.menu2 {
width: 116px;
}
.menu3 {
width: 104px;
}
.menu4 {
width: 103px;
}
.menu5 {
width: 97px;
}
.menu6 {
width: 59px;
}
.menu1 {background-image: url(images/bg-bouton-menu1.gif);}
.menu2 {background-image: url(images/bg-bouton-menu2.gif);}
.menu3 {background-image: url(images/bg-bouton-menu3.gif);}
.menu4 {background-image: url(images/bg-bouton-menu4.gif);}
.menu5 {background-image: url(images/bg-bouton-menu5.gif);}
.menu6 {background-image: url(images/bg-bouton-menu6.gif);}

.menu1:hover , .menu2:hover , .menu3:hover , .menu4:hover , .menu5:hover , .menu6:hover, .active {
background-position: bottom;
}
